Biography
Cindy Tanner, RN, CLNC, MBA (c), LNHA
Cindy Tanner is an accomplished healthcare executive, licensed nurse, and Certified Legal Nurse Consultant (CLNC) with over 25 years of experience spanning acute care, long-term care, sub-acute rehabilitation, and orthopedic coordination. As the founder of CaseCorrect, LLC, she integrates clinical expertise and strategic leadership to deliver consulting, education, and advocacy services that improve care quality and organizational performance.
Cindy currently serves as Vice President of Healthcare Services at Brewster Place, a nationally recognized continuing care retirement community. Her leadership has played a pivotal role in the organization’s 5-STAR CMS rating and national accolades from U.S. News & World Report and Newsweek.
Her clinical foundation includes medical-surgical nursing, IV therapy, and orthopedic program development. She held roles as an Orthopedic Coordinator and later as a frontline RN during the COVID-19 pandemic, where she led care transitions and upheld stringent infection prevention protocols.
Cindy is a Licensed Nursing Home Administrator and has been a CLNC since 2019. She also holds a CPR Instructor certification and a professional coaching credential. Her consulting practice focuses on:
- Mock surveys & regulatory readiness
- Leadership coaching & team development
- Policy and documentation compliance
- Case reviews for attorneys and healthcare teams
- Workshops and public speaking on aging, culture change, leadership, and quality improvement
Recognized for her calm presence, intentional leadership, and unwavering commitment to person-centered care, Cindy partners with organizations to strengthen operations, elevate quality outcomes, and develop high-performing teams across both healthcare and legal-medical sectors.
